Contract for services

Options
Hi, I had a contract with a dog walker and I have cancelled due to a dispute at the times he was being walked. I am having issues getting a refund and have lost my copy of the contract. So far she is refusing to acknowledge my request for a copy. Do I have any legal standing or right to get a copy?

    Contracts don't need to be in writing so there may not be a paper copy.


    You admit you had a contract so that's good enough, actions such as payments to them back up the proof of this contract.


    You simply aren't allowed in law to just cancel a contract without penalty unless you can prove a breach of this contract.
